CVE-2025-14098: Heap Buffer Overflow Vulnerability in Avira Antivirus Engine (Pre-8.3.70.104)
Summary
A heap buffer out-of-bounds write vulnerability (CVE-2025-14098) exists in the Avira Antivirus engine due to an integer overflow when scanning malformed MS-DOS executable files. This flaw could allow local execution of code or denial-of-service of the antivirus engine process. The vulnerability affects Avira Antivirus on Windows, macOS, and Linux for engine builds before version 8.3.70.104.
